Revisions of pangomm

Dominique Leuenberger's avatar Dominique Leuenberger (dimstar_suse) accepted request 1159762 from Dominique Leuenberger's avatar Dominique Leuenberger (dimstar) (revision 48)
- Update to version 2.52.0:
  + FontFamily: Add property_item_type(), property_n_items(),
    property_name(), property_is_monospace(),
    property_is_variable().
  + FontMap: Add reload_font(), property_item_type(),
    property_n_items().

- Update to version 2.50.2:
  + Fontset: Use callback functions with C linkage.
  + Coverage: Don't use deprecated pango_coverage_ref/unref().
  + Documentation:
    - Doxyfile.in: Don't hide undocumented classes.
    - README.win32: Convert to MarkDown and rename to
      README.win32.md.
    - Make dependencies clearer.
    - Remove AUTHORS, HACKING, README.SUN; add general info to
      README.md.
  + Meson build:
    - Detect if we build from a git subtree.
    - Don't copy files with configure_file().
    - Fix the evaluation of is_git_build on Windows.
    - Don't fail if warning_level=everything.
Dominique Leuenberger's avatar Dominique Leuenberger (dimstar_suse) accepted request 922034 from Dominique Leuenberger's avatar Dominique Leuenberger (dimstar) (revision 44)
- Update to version 2.48.1:
  + GlyphItem: Fix a memory leak in split()
  + Layout: Speed up get_log_attrs()
  + Build:
    - Meson build: Use relative paths to untracked/
    - pangommconfig.h.*: Don't dllimport on MinGW
    - Meson build: Make it possible to use pangomm as a subproject
    - Meson build: No implicit_include_directories
- Add pangomm-docs-without-timestamp.patch: Do not add timestamp to
  generated doc files. (forwarded request 922032 from iznogood)
Dominique Leuenberger's avatar Dominique Leuenberger (dimstar_suse) accepted request 857826 from Dominique Leuenberger's avatar Dominique Leuenberger (dimstar) (revision 43)
- Update to version 2.48.0:
  + FontFamily, FontMap: Implement the Gio::ListModel interface
    CairoFontMap: Add get_default()
  + Attribute: Add Overline and ShowFlags enums and some create*()
    methods Renderer: Add vfuncs
  + Font, FontFace, FontFamily, FontMetrics: Add new methods
  + LayoutRun: Rename to GlyphItem
  + LayoutIter: Fix get_run() and get_line()
  + GlyphString, Item: Wrap pango_shape_with_flags()
  + Layout: Add set/get_line_spacing()
  + Build:
    - Depend on giomm (not just glibmm)
    - Use __declspec(dllexport) when building with Visual Studio
    - Meson build: Avoid some recompilations
    - Meson build: Better error message if trying to build with
      maintainer-mode=false when true is necessary
    - Meson build: Set default value of the 'warnings' option to
      'min'
    - Improve NMake support
    - Improve Visual Studio support
    - docs/reference/: Update for Doxygen >= 1.8.16
    - Meson build: Fix versioning on macOS
    - Change the ABI to pangomm-2.48
- Add meson BuildRequires and macros following upstreams port.
- Bump base_ver and libname (and in baselibs.conf) following
  upstream changes.
- Add doxygen, graphviz and xsltproc BuildRequires, needed to build
  documentation now.
- Replace pkgconfig(glibmm-2.66) with pkgconfig(giomm-2.68) and
  pkgconfig(glibmm-2.68) BuildRequires following upstream changes.
- Drop libtool and mm-common BuildRequires, no longer needed. (forwarded request 856993 from iznogood)
Dominique Leuenberger's avatar Dominique Leuenberger (dimstar_suse) accepted request 795243 from Dominique Leuenberger's avatar Dominique Leuenberger (dimstar) (revision 42)
Scripted push of project GNOME:Next (forwarded request 795098 from iznogood)
Dominique Leuenberger's avatar Dominique Leuenberger (dimstar_suse) accepted request 736599 from Dominique Leuenberger's avatar Dominique Leuenberger (dimstar) (revision 41)
Scripted push from {project}
Dominique Leuenberger's avatar Dominique Leuenberger (dimstar_suse) accepted request 603957 from Dominique Leuenberger's avatar Dominique Leuenberger (dimstar) (revision 39)
- Export CXXFLAGS="-std=c++17" until upstream catches up: required,
  as libsigc++-3.0 moved to C++17. (forwarded request 603953 from iznogood)
Dominique Leuenberger's avatar Dominique Leuenberger (dimstar_suse) accepted request 585451 from Dominique Leuenberger's avatar Dominique Leuenberger (dimstar) (revision 37)
- Update to version 2.41.5:
Dominique Leuenberger's avatar Dominique Leuenberger (dimstar_suse) accepted request 522768 from Dominique Leuenberger's avatar Dominique Leuenberger (dimstar) (revision 36)
- Update package summaries.
  Avoid running fdupes across hardlink boundaries. (forwarded request 522746 from jengelh)
Dominique Leuenberger's avatar Dominique Leuenberger (dimstar_suse) accepted request 399433 from Dominique Leuenberger's avatar Dominique Leuenberger (dimstar) (revision 33)
Sync package with SLE12SP2 - just for easier tracking (forwarded request 399230 from dimstar)
Dominique Leuenberger's avatar Dominique Leuenberger (dimstar_suse) accepted request 364337 from Dominique Leuenberger's avatar Dominique Leuenberger (dimstar) (revision 31)
Scripted push of project GNOME:Factory
Dominique Leuenberger's avatar Dominique Leuenberger (dimstar_suse) accepted request 293044 from Dominique Leuenberger's avatar Dominique Leuenberger (dimstar) (revision 30)
Update to 2.36.0 (forwarded request 292873 from dimstar)
Adrian Schröter's avatar Adrian Schröter (adrianSuSE) committed (revision 29)
Split 13.2 from Factory
Displaying revisions 1 - 20 of 48
openSUSE Build Service is sponsored by